Пример #1
0
        public ContractorsListForm()
        {
            InitializeComponent();

            query = new QueryContractors();

            this.Text = Properties.Resources.Contractors;

            labelSearch.Text         = Properties.Resources.Search;
            labelContractorType.Text = Properties.Resources.ContractorType;


            buttonCreate.Text  = Properties.Resources.Create;
            buttonEdit.Text    = Properties.Resources.Edit;
            buttonDelete.Text  = Properties.Resources.Delete;
            buttonRefresh.Text = Properties.Resources.Refresh;
            buttonSearch.Text  = Properties.Resources.Search;

            dataGridView1.SelectionMode       = DataGridViewSelectionMode.FullRowSelect;
            dataGridView1.ReadOnly            = true;
            dataGridView1.AllowUserToAddRows  = false;
            dataGridView1.RowHeadersVisible   = false;
            dataGridView1.AutoSizeColumnsMode = DataGridViewAutoSizeColumnsMode.Fill;
            dataGridView1.AutoSizeRowsMode    = DataGridViewAutoSizeRowsMode.AllCells;
            dataGridView1.ScrollBars          = ScrollBars.Both;

            DataGridViewTextBoxColumn col00 = new DataGridViewTextBoxColumn();

            col00.HeaderText = Properties.Resources.ID;

            DataGridViewTextBoxColumn col0 = new DataGridViewTextBoxColumn();

            col0.HeaderText = Properties.Resources.Title;

            DataGridViewTextBoxColumn col1 = new DataGridViewTextBoxColumn();

            col1.HeaderText = Properties.Resources.ContractorType;


            dataGridView1.Columns.Add(col00);
            dataGridView1.Columns.Add(col0);
            dataGridView1.Columns.Add(col1);

            addGridView(query.querySelectContractors(0));

            List <ObjectComboBox> lObj = new List <ObjectComboBox>();

            lObj.Add(new ObjectComboBox(0, Properties.Resources.All));
            lObj.Add(new ObjectComboBox(1, Properties.Resources.Customer));
            lObj.Add(new ObjectComboBox(2, Properties.Resources.Provider));

            comboBoxContractorType.DataSource = lObj;

            comboBoxContractorType.ValueMember   = "Id";
            comboBoxContractorType.DisplayMember = "Name";
        }
Пример #2
0
        public SuppluEditForm(SupplyListForm instance)
        {
            this.instance = instance;

            InitializeComponent();

            query            = new QueryContractSupply();
            queryProd        = new QueryProducts();
            queryContractors = new QueryContractors();

            this.Text             = Properties.Resources.Supply;
            labelId.Text          = Properties.Resources.SupplyContract;
            label2.Text           = Properties.Resources.Date;
            label3.Text           = Properties.Resources.Goods;
            label4.Text           = Properties.Resources.Number;
            labelAmount.Text      = Properties.Resources.Amount;
            labelWasReceived.Text = Properties.Resources.Received;
            labelContractors.Text = Properties.Resources.Contractor;

            buttonCancel.Text = Properties.Resources.Cancel;
            buttonOK.Text     = Properties.Resources.OK;

            ArrayList lObjPr = new ArrayList();

            foreach (var item in queryProd.querySelectProducts())
            {
                lObjPr.Add(new { Id = item.Id, Name = item.Name });
            }

            comboBoxProducts.DataSource    = lObjPr;
            comboBoxProducts.ValueMember   = "Id";
            comboBoxProducts.DisplayMember = "Name";

            List <bool> lObjBool = new List <bool> {
                true, false
            };

            comboBoxWasReceived.DataSource = lObjBool;

            ArrayList lObjContr = new ArrayList();

            foreach (var item in queryContractors.querySelectContractors(2))
            {
                lObjContr.Add(new { Id = item.Id, Name = item.Name });
            }

            comboBoxContractors.DataSource    = lObjContr;
            comboBoxContractors.ValueMember   = "Id";
            comboBoxContractors.DisplayMember = "Name";
        }
Пример #3
0
        public ContractorEditForm(ContractorsListForm instance)
        {
            this.instance = instance;
            InitializeComponent();

            query = new QueryContractors();

            this.Text = Properties.Resources.Contractor;

            label1.Text = Properties.Resources.ContractorType;
            label2.Text = Properties.Resources.Title;

            comboBox1.DataSource = new List <String> {
                Properties.Resources.Customer, Properties.Resources.Provider
            };

            buttonCancel.Text = Properties.Resources.Cancel;
            buttonOK.Text     = Properties.Resources.OK;
        }